Job Description

As a Manager of Systems Engineering, you will oversee a team responsible for designing, building and scaling our global public cloud infrastructure systems that are at the heart of the ServiceNow product, running in AWS and Azure.

This role provides technical leadership to the engineering team, interfaces with product development teams on new systems and enhancements of existing systems, recruiting, team development and creation of key performance metrics.

Key to success is the ability to drive technical issues to completion across a global team through effective cross-organizational efforts.

What you get to do in this role :

  • Lead the engineering team responsible for the definition, configuration, delivery, and validation of compute across our private and public cloud infrastructure.
  • Work with Product and Program management to define and communicate the team’s external commitments and roadmap.
  • Facilitate engineering team autonomy by assisting with project planning, prioritization, Agile process, and skill development.
  • Support growth of engineers via hiring, goal setting, development of individual development plans, and performance reviews.
  • Provide technical guidance for systems and process optimization opportunities and participate in architectural reviews.
  • Assess risks, vulnerabilities, and mitigations of core services to ensure these systems are highly available, operationally sound, perform at scale and exceed customer expectations.
  • Collaborate with peer teams on complex, global engineering efforts to ensure architecture agreement, resource coordination and implementation timelines.
  • Set and sustain technical standards and best-practices in your domain.

Qualifications

To be successful in this role you have :

  • 6+ years’ experience leading systems / software / hardware development and engineering for public and private cloud infrastructure
  • Expert level experience with release management and DevOps across a global 24x7 cloud production environment.
  • Deep technical fluency in Linux and data center technologies, infrastructure automation, DevOps practices and software engineering principles.
  • Proficient with the components of infrastructure including hardware platforms, OS, virtualization, AWS public cloud, Azure public cloud, GCP, and web applications and databases.
  • Public cloud experience running production services at scale : (Azure, AWS, GCP, etc.)
  • Experience with configuration management platforms at scale.
  • Demonstrated success balancing competing priorities in a fast-moving environment.
  • Ability to define problems, collect data, establish facts, and draw valid conclusions.
  • Work cross-functionally to build consensus and drive complex projects and issues to completion.
  • Ability to drive technical direction while supporting engineering autonomy and creativity.
  • Outstanding communication skills.

For positions in the Seattle metro / Kirkland areas, we offer a base pay of $158,500 - $277,500, plus equity (when applicable), variable / incentive compensation and benefits.

Sales positions generally offer a competitive On Target Earnings (OTE) incentive compensation structure. Please note that the base pay shown is a guideline, and individual total compensation will vary based on factors such as qualifications, skill level, competencies and work location.

We also offer health plans, including flexible spending accounts, a 401(k) Plan with company match, ESPP, matching donations, a flexible time away plan and family leave programs (subject to eligibility requirements).

Compensation is based on the geographic location in which the role is located, and is subject to change based on work location.
